The US dollar is rising, Treasury yields are climbing — and Bitcoin stubbornly refuses to fall. That split personality is driving crypto market dynamics.

Fresh US inflation data came in hotter than expected, strengthening the dollar and pushing Treasury yields higher. Markets are once again talking about the possibility of Fed tightening rather than easing. That is a classic headwind for Bitcoin: higher yields raise the opportunity cost of holding a token in an ETF, and capital tends to rotate into bonds.

On Thursday Bitcoin fell for a fourth session in a row, slipping back below $80,000. Risk appetite was also dented by rising Middle East tensions: Brent jumped above $107/bbl, while equities and bonds sold off after the inflation print. The pullback so far remains within Bitcoin's familiar February?onward range of $60,000–80,000, but repeated failed attempts to hold above $80,000 highlight uneven demand.

Inside the crypto market, the picture is mixed. A wave of short?liquidations on Ethereum triggered a brief rally on Friday: Ethereum jumped at the fastest pace since the prior surge three weeks ago, while Bitcoin gained less than 4%. Coinglass data show about $300 million in Ethereum short positions were liquidated in a day, versus $212 million in Bitcoin. That divergence suggests speculators have shifted interest to other digital assets while BTC/USD stalls.

Against that backdrop the $320 million exploit of the Liquid Network is a secondary story. Formally it helps Bitcoin ETFs: scared retail is moving funds into regulated vehicles. But ETF inflows don't outweigh the pressure from a stronger dollar and rising yields — macro remains the dominant driver.

Structural notes Wintermute points out that derivatives markets still tell a bullish year?end story despite the current consolidation and fading momentum. There's also a structural change in mining supply: US miners' compute capacity fell 18% by October 2025 as sites were repurposed into data centers, but that freed capacity has migrated to China and Russia and has had little impact on BTC/USD prices.

Bottom line Bitcoin is being tugged by several forces at once: a firmer dollar, rising Treasury yields, localized speculative demand for Ether, and targeted ETF flows after the hack. Which force will win the tug?of?war remains uncertain.

Technically, on the daily chart, BTC/USD still faces the risk of activating an Anti?Turtles reversal pattern. That would require a confirmed test of support at $76,350, which would set up shorts. Re?engaging buyers makes sense only after a move back above $79,850.
